The prestigious MOTORWORLD Book Prize was awarded for the 20th time on Wednesday at Motorworld M\u00fcnchen. The five-member jury selected the best automotive works of the year from the around 90 new publications that had been submitted. Awards were presented to titles in the categories &#8220;Brand&#8221;, &#8220;History&#8221;, &#8220;Biography&#8221;, &#8220;Motorsport&#8221;, &#8220;Design&#8221; and &#8220;New Works from Great Britain and the USA&#8221;. The origins of the family-run company date back to 1930. The Motorworld Group develops, builds and operates worlds of experience dedicated to mobile passion, and as a whole is considered to be the world&#8217;s largest brand-neutral centre for classic cars and sports cars, winning many national and international awards. With over 40 of the world&#8217;s most valuable and exclusive vehicle brands, it brings together the brand who&#8217;s who of the entire mobility industry.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The first location was Motorworld Region Stuttgart in B\u00f6blingen, which opened in 2009 and has since been expanded several times.
